/**
 * Utility to handle indirect drawing.
 *
 * Create a {@link buffer}, fill it with all the added {@link geometries} attributes and tell all the {@link geometries} to start using this {@link buffer} for indirect drawing.
 *
 * @example
 * ```javascript
 * const geometry = new Geometry()
 *
 * // assuming 'renderer' is a valid renderer or curtains instance
 * const indirectBuffer = new IndirectBuffer(renderer, {
 *   label: 'Custom indirect buffer',
 *   geometries: [geometry]
 * })
 *
 * // if every geometries have been added, create the buffer.
 * indirectBuffer.create()
 *
 * // from now on, any Mesh using 'geometry' as geometry will be rendered using indirect drawing.
 * ```
 */
